Output 83d65031b8de0c17868ec6713463036633233d1367bc083a28ef8d2dbfc6c903:42

value
40960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d056eb9611f93f201b6d327aaf2c27c198fff78 OP_EQUAL
address
3D64typJpHHWcJAcaVRNv7KFDKXcdQoMoP
transaction
83d65031b8de0c17868ec6713463036633233d1367bc083a28ef8d2dbfc6c903
spent
true